Euchre is a 4-player partnership trick-taking game. You and your partner (across the table) compete against two AI opponents. First team to 10 points wins the match.
Euchre uses a 24-card deck — 9, 10, J, Q, K, A in each of the four suits. Five cards are dealt to each player, and one card is turned face-up to propose trump.
The turned-up card's suit is proposed as trump. In the first round, each player can "Order it up" (accept that suit as trump) or "Pass." If all pass, a second round lets players name any OTHER suit as trump. The team that calls trump is the makers — they must win at least 3 tricks.
The Right Bower (Jack of trump) is the highest card. The Left Bower (Jack of the same color) is the second highest. These two Jacks outrank everything — even Aces of trump.
The player left of the dealer leads the first trick. You must follow suit if you can. If you can't, you may play any card (including trump). The highest card of the led suit wins — unless trump is played, in which case the highest trump wins.
Makers win 3-4 tricks: +1 point. All 5 tricks (march): +2 points. Makers fail (euchred): opponents get +2. Going alone and winning all 5: +4 points.
